  • Patent number: 4575360
    Abstract: A slip type driveline assembly with a one piece sealing member to prevent loss and contamination of lubricant. The slip type assembly is generally of a sliding spline design. A spline plug is fitted into a slip yoke with an internal spline that generally mates with the external spline of the spline plug. A tube and weld yoke assembly is generally pressure fit and welded to the spline plug. Universal joint assemblies are attached to each yoke completing the assembly. The splined cavity within the slip yoke generally contains lubricants and is sealed by a plug and a seal which keeps the lubricants in and contaminants out. The sealing member is made of a resilient material and is of one piece construction. The sealing member has a cylindrical wall and integral radially inwardly extending circumferential annulus. The wall and annulus generally complement and mate with the cylindrical end of the slip yoke that has a groove on its surface to receive the annulus.

  • Patent number: 4556400
    Abstract: A drive shaft assembly particulary suited for power transmission in motor vehicles wherein a drive shaft has a universal joint connected to at least one end thereof with a sealing boot attached in sealing engagement between the outer joint member of the universal joint and the drive shaft. The invention is particularly directed to the provision of an elastomeric cover on the outer surface of the drive shaft, the elastomeric cover extending along the shaft from the exterior of the sealing boot to within the region enclosed by the boot in order to provide an arrangement which is resistant to damage, corrosion, and wear and which may be conveniently fitted and assembled. The elastomeric cover may be provided with internal ribs to establish ventilation channels for the shaft assembly.
